US DV Lottery Visa Status Check for 2025

The entrant check page online is the only way for individuals to check their Diversity Visa status online. States Department will not contact the successful applicants about their status through email, SMS, or written confirmation. One has to check it through the online status page only.

DV-2025 Opening Dates

The DV-2025 lottery opened on 4 October 2023 and closed on 7 November 2023. The applicants from eligible countries could submit online applications to be one of the 55,000 lucky entrants. How to apply for a DV immigrant visa after selection?

You can only check your selection on the online Diversity Visa selection page. If you have been selected, you will see their details about the application process for you and eligible family members. You must keep your entrant confirmation number till 30 September 2025.

Immigrant Visa (Green Card) Application Time

The announcement allowed time for applying for the Green Card has been set as follows:

  • Start Date: 1 October 2024
  • End Date: 30 September 2025

One should apply as soon as possible once their program rank number is eligible.

What is the Diversity Visa Lottery Program?

The diversity visa lottery is for people of courtiers who have historically low rates of immigration to the United States. The people from countries having excessive rates of United States immigration are not able to register.

A total quota of 55,000 is allocated every year for the applicants to apply for the program. Through an online application system, applicants are allowed to apply for the lottery visa (Green Card) selection process if they are from an eligible country. They can also add data on their children and spouses in the application form.

Applicants are provided with an entrance confirmation number which can be used to access the State Department webpage to check the application status. Once selected through the lottery process, applicants can apply for a Green Card (immigrant visa) under the given allowed dates.
